Full Job Description

Location: Vilnius, Lithuania

Join our Third Party Risk Management team to help Danske Bank safely engage with vendors and partners across the Nordics. You will work at the intersection of risk management and business strategy, ensuring the bank's resilience while supporting informed decision-making. This is your opportunity to influence key business decisions whilst developing your expertise in an evolving risk landscape.

What you will be doing:
As part of our Third Party Risk Management team, you will collaborate with experts across Risk, Compliance, Security, and Technology to manage supplier relationships throughout their lifecycle. Working closely with colleagues in the Nordic countries and Lithuania, you will evaluate complex risks and provide practical recommendations that support business objectives whilst maintaining regulatory compliance.
    Lead third-party risk assessments across the entire supplier lifecycle
    Partner with stakeholders to identify and manage vendor risks effectively
    Evaluate operational, regulatory, information security, and financial crime risks
    Provide risk-based recommendations that support sound business decisions
    Contribute to continuous improvement of TPRM frameworks and methodologies
    Support implementation of regulatory requirements including DORA standards
    Promote risk awareness and best practices across the organisation

About you:
    Experience in risk management, procurement, or vendor management
    Strong stakeholder management skills and relationship-building abilities
    Analytical mindset with ability to assess complex situations practically
    Understanding of regulatory requirements for financial institutions
    Knowledge of information security, operational resilience, or supplier risk management
    Ability to balance risk, regulatory expectations, and business objectives
    Strong written and verbal communication skills in English
    Higher education in risk, business, finance, law, or related field
    Experience with strategic supplier decisions in financial services would be valuable, along with familiarity with GDPR or outsourcing frameworks.
